WebThe fundamental nature of Cython can be summed up as follows: Cython is Python with C data types. Cython is Python: Almost any piece of Python code is also valid Cython code. (There are a few Limitations, but this approximation will serve for now.) The Cython compiler will convert it into C code which makes equivalent calls to the Python/C API. WebApr 2, 2024 · The Cython language makes writing C extensions for the Python language as easy as Python itself. Cython is a source code translator based on Pyrex , but supports more cutting edge functionality and optimizations. WebCython is a hybrid Python/hinted language. In the most basic form it takes the Python code and makes a C file that wraps and calls the Python interpreter. In most cases this has little difference from just running the Python interpreter.
